Questions & Answers

Q: How can JavaScript be used to dynamically assign CSS classes to DOM elements?

JavaScript can be used to create DOM elements and assign them classes, allowing for the application of predefined CSS styles dynamically.

Q: Can you explain how to toggle classes on DOM elements using JavaScript?

By toggling classes on DOM elements, you can dynamically change their appearance by adding or removing CSS styles based on user interactions.

Q: What is the significance of assigning classes and styles to DOM elements dynamically?

Dynamically assigning classes and styles to DOM elements allows for flexible and responsive web design, making it easier to manage and update styling across multiple elements.

Q: How can parent and child relationships be utilized with p5 variables in web development?

Parent and child relationships with p5 variables can streamline the manipulation and styling of DOM elements, offering more control and customization in web development projects.
